About the role
Key responsibilities & impact- Build strong knowledge of Caterpillar, its products, services, and customers
- Grow through hands-on technical training and professional development
- Collaborate with experts across product, marketing, sales, and dealer management
- Complete diverse rotational assignments to gain enterprise-wide exposure
- Serve as a key connection between Caterpillar and its dealer network
Requirements
What you’ll need- Bachelor's degree in Business, Marketing, Engineering, or related field (or equivalent experience)
- Must currently be participating in a Caterpillar Student & Graduate Program
- Minimum GPA of 2.8/4.0 (if applicable)
- Willingness to travel extensively (50–75%)
- Willingness to relocate domestically based on business needs
- Must be authorized to work in the U.S. (no sponsorship available).
